Use Fiddler para simular un entorno de red débil y probar el rendimiento de la aplicación

En muchos casos, necesitamos simular diferentes entornos de red para verificar la respuesta del producto. Podemos usar la herramienta Fiddler para controlar.
Las operaciones específicas son las siguientes:
1. Verifique ip
win + R en su PC , ingrese cmd para abrir el comando en segundo plano e ingrese ipconfig para ver su dirección IPv4

2. Determine el puerto que escucha su Fiddler, generalmente el valor predeterminado es 8888

3. El teléfono móvil está conectado a wifi y luego al agente, ip es su propia dirección IPv4 y el puerto es 8888. Opere en el teléfono móvil para ver si Fiddler puede atrapar el paquete, si lo hay, el agente del teléfono móvil y la computadora tienen éxito

4. Configure la velocidad de Internet de Fiddler.
Inserte la descripción de la imagen aquí
Busque el siguiente código y configure la velocidad de Internet que desea simular:

    if (m_SimulateModem) {
        // Delay sends by 300ms per KB uploaded. //每延迟300ms发送1kb的数据,也就是每1s发送10/3kb的数据
        oSession["request-trickle-delay"] = "300"; 
        // Delay receives by 150ms per KB downloaded.//每延迟150ms下行1kb的数据
        oSession["response-trickle-delay"] = "150"; 
    }

Modifique el valor, por ejemplo, oSession ["request-trickle-delay"] = "300"; Modifique a 1000, cuanto mayor sea el valor, mayor será el tiempo para enviar 1 kb de datos es la diferencia en la velocidad de la red.

5. Habilite la velocidad del módem analógico Fiddler configurado
Inserte la descripción de la imagen aquí
6. Continúe operando el teléfono, verá que los datos se extraerán muy lentamente, lo que demuestra que ha simulado con éxito en un entorno de red débil. ! !

Publicado 22 artículos originales · elogiado 5 · visitas 4318

Supongo que te gusta

Origin blog.csdn.net/weixin_42231208/article/details/96500081
Recomendado
Clasificación